Spraying with a solution of green copper vitriol (ferrous sulfate) is used to eliminate moss in lawns. Green copper vitriol, a moss control agent, is a fertilizer intended for supplementing plants during the growing season by spraying the solution on the leaves.
Green copper vitriol is a fertilizer intended for fertilizing strawberries, fruit trees and saplings, grapevines, conifers, and ornamental lawns. Green copper vitriol is a fast-acting fertilizer designed to supplement iron in plant nutrition during the growing season. Iron is an essential nutrient that affects chlorophyll production, growth, coloration, and the appearance of plants.
Iron deficiency manifests mainly in pome fruit, stone fruit, strawberries, and grapevines as local leaf yellowing, known as chlorosis (yellowing), leading to damage and reduced fruit yields. In ornamental lawns, deficiency manifests as damage to health, appearance, and the formation of undesirable mosses and lichens. These can be effectively removed by spraying a dissolved mixture of green copper vitriol with ammonium sulfate.
Disinfection:
Used for treating drinking, surface, and technological waters (most effective in alkaline pH areas) and for cleaning wastewater. Can also be used as a disinfectant for livestock hoof diseases.
Dyeing:
This substance provides colored compounds during reactions, which are utilized for dyeing. An organometallic compound with gallic acid was historically used as ink.
